What is Precision Point Diagnostics
Precision Point Diagnostics is a clinical laboratory that provides testing across immune response, hormone health, thyroid function, and wellness biomarkers.
The laboratory offers blood and saliva-based assays designed to measure biomarkers that may provide insight into dietary antigen responses, endocrine function, and physiological patterns. Testing is ordered by licensed healthcare practitioners and is used to support clinical assessment and care planning.

Frequently ordered Precision Point Diagnostics tests
P88 Dietary Antigen Test
A serum test that evaluates IgE, IgG, IgG4, and complement (C3d) responses to a panel of 88 dietary antigens. The standard P88 requires a phlebotomy blood draw; an at-home fingerstick microsample version (P88-DIY) is also available for practitioner-ordered use, with the sample self-collected by the patient after the practitioner initiates the order.
Often considered when assessing food-related immune patterns.

Advanced Adrenal Stress Test
A saliva-based test that evaluates a 4-point cortisol curve along with DHEA and secretory IgA (sIgA).
Often considered when assessing stress-related and adrenal patterns.
